First and foremost, it’s important to set a budget for your wedding dress. Wedding dresses come in a wide range of prices, so it’s important to have a clear idea of how much you are willing to spend before you start shopping. This will help you narrow down your options and prevent you from falling in love with a dress that is out of your price range. Remember to consider alterations, accessories, and other associated costs when setting your budget.

Next, do your homework and research different styles of wedding dresses to determine what you like and what suits your body type. There are several different silhouettes to choose from, including A-line, ball gown, mermaid, sheath, and more. Consider trying on different styles to see what flatters your figure and makes you feel beautiful. Don’t be afraid to step out of your comfort zone and try on dresses you may not have initially considered.

When it comes to shopping for wedding dresses, timing is key. Most bridal boutiques recommend starting the dress shopping process at least nine to twelve months before your wedding date. This will give you enough time to find the perfect dress, place your order, and allow for any necessary alterations. Keep in mind that some designers require several months to create a custom dress, so be sure to plan ahead.

When scheduling appointments at bridal boutiques, be sure to bring along any important decision-makers, such as your mother or Maid of Honor. However, be mindful of bringing too many opinions, as this can make the decision-making process overwhelming. It’s important to choose a dress that makes you feel beautiful and confident, so trust your own instincts and listen to your own voice.

When trying on dresses, pay attention to the fit and comfort of each dress. You will be spending several hours in your wedding dress on your big day, so it’s important to choose a dress that is comfortable and allows you to move freely. Be sure to sit, stand, walk, and dance in each dress to ensure it fits properly and feels good on your body.
